"Crimson"
Red · Spring
🧠 Psychology
Emotional and creative color. Evokes transformation, innovation and modern femininity.
✨ Uses
Fashion, beauty, youth marketing, creative tech.
Tip
Crimson pairs ideally with #F7F5F0 (off-white) and a neutral background for a modern, readable result.
